About The Links Kennedy Bay

Links Kennedy Bay is a highly regarded golf club located in Port Kennedy, Western Australia. It is situated on the coast, offering stunning ocean views and a challenging golfing experience. Here are some notable features of Links Kennedy Bay: 1. Designed by Michael Coate and Roger Mackay: The golf course was designed by the renowned architect duo, Michael Coate and Roger Mackay. They have incorporated the natural dunes and coastal landscape into the course, adding to its beauty and difficulty. 2. Championship-level course: Links Kennedy Bay is recognized as a championship-level golf course, where numerous prestigious events have been hosted. It is known for its well-maintained fairways, challenging bunkers, and fast greens, providing a thrilling game for golfers of all skill levels. 3. Picturesque coastal setting: The golf course boasts breathtaking views of the Western Australian coastline. Golfers can enjoy playing amidst rolling sand dunes, native vegetation, and glimpses of the Indian Ocean, creating a visually stunning and serene atmosphere. 4. Varied playing conditions: Links Kennedy Bay offers a mix of holes, ranging from short and strategic par-4s to long, challenging par-5s. The course provides a good balance of holes with different degrees of difficulty, allowing players to test their skills and creativity. 5. Facilities and services: The club provides various amenities to enhance the overall golfing experience. These include a pro shop, practice facilities, and a clubhouse with a restaurant and bar, where golfers can relax and enjoy a meal or drink after their round. 6. Environmental commitment: Links Kennedy Bay is committed to environmental sustainability. The management takes several measures to conserve water, manage waste responsibly, and protect the natural habitat within the course. Overall, Links Kennedy Bay is a prestigious and visually captivating golf club offering a challenging experience in a stunning coastal setting.

Course details

  • Number of holes: 18
  • Par: 72
  • Standard Scratch Score: 70
  • Tees available: 4
